The Metro Detroit area hosts a comprehensive range of Academic and STEM summer camps tailored for students from kindergarten through 12th grade, offering a perfect blend of education and summer fun. These camps provide opportunities for children to explore subjects such as coding, robotics, engineering, and medical fields, with some camps allowing high school students to earn college credits. Younger campers engage in science-themed games and projects that foster curiosity and learning, while older students dive into more advanced academic topics, arts, and college preparation workshops. Spread across various cities including Bloomfield Hills, Detroit, Farmington Hills, Flint, and Rochester, the camps are conducted in schools, colleges, museums, and dedicated camp facilities. They often include hands-on activities, immersive learning experiences, and the chance to learn from professionals and educators. Whether it’s technology camps for special needs students or language immersion programs, Metro Detroit’s Academic/STEM summer camps provide enriching programs designed to inspire and educate, with day and some overnight camp options available.
